Description
Edit PDFs with natural-language instructions using the nano-pdf CLI.
Usage Guidance
Install this only if you trust the nano-pdf PyPI package. Keep originals or backups of important PDFs, and review edited PDFs before sending, publishing, or overwriting important documents.

Capability Assessment
Purpose & Capability
The purpose and capability fit together: it installs and invokes the nano-pdf CLI to edit a user-specified PDF page from a natural-language instruction. The core behavior can modify document contents, so users should review outputs before relying on them.
Instruction Scope
Runtime instructions are narrow and user-directed, with a single example command and an explicit reminder to sanity-check the output PDF. There are no instructions for broad file scanning, credential use, hidden automation, or background work.
Install Mechanism
Installation uses uv to fetch the external nano-pdf package from PyPI and expose the nano-pdf binary. This is coherent with the skill purpose, though the package version is not pinned in the artifact.
Credentials
The declared requirement is limited to the nano-pdf binary and a user-provided PDF path. The artifact does not request tokens, account access, profile stores, broad local indexing, or unrelated network access.
Persistence & Privilege
No persistence mechanism, elevated privilege request, autorun behavior, long-running worker, or destructive system operation is described.
